We recently spoke with Sturgeon Bay elementary school counselor Karlie Martens about maintaining and improving mental health services in Sturgeon Bay schools now during the pandemic. Martens told us all school counselors in the district provide classroom guidance and social skills sessions. Every week she provides this type of instruction which can continue through high school. Martens says many schools across the county are working to get mental health counselors into their buildings because the need is there, especially during a public health emergency.
